1994 Ford Ranger XLT You are looking at a truck that is practically good as a new one! I have receipts totaling $11,166.95 ( eleven thousand, one hundred and sixty six dollars and ninety five cents ) for new paint, new parts and labor that have been spent on this truck . Under the hood is a new 3.0 V6 crate long block engine with 2 years and the remainder of the 100,000 miles warranty, a reconditioned radiator and plastic cooling fan. Of course, all the hoses and belts are new. Also a new complete dual exhaust system including the exhaust manifold, clutch kit ( clutch, throw-out bearing, pressure plate, slave cylinder), all new front end parts (ball joints, tie rods, power steering pump, wheel hubs and drums , shock absorbers) complete new brakes on all wheels, new alternator, starter, fuel pump, etc. New wheels and tires, sliding back glass, new interior (carpet, headliner, seat and dash cover, etc), new lockable aluminum toolbox, sprayed in bedliner, new windshield and tinted windows. It also has a new Sony remote controlled Sony stereo system with Fosgate amplifier and Fosgate 10 inch sub-woofer. Please note the tachometer, and water temp and oil pressure gauges on pod mounted on driver’s door post and also custom steering wheel. It also has new in-dash white face gauges, with changeable ambient blue or green colors for the dash gauges. There are cool blue L.E.D. lights under dash and behind seats for the night time cruising along with clear L.E.D. running lights in the grill. I am sure there are a lot of parts that I have forgotten to list and as one can see no expense was spared to put this truck in the condition as you see it! This truck drives as new, the shifter is tight, and with the 5 speed manual transmission she gets 18 mpg city and 23 mpg highway on regular 87 octane gas. The total miles on this truck today is 134,600 subject to change as this truck is driven daily. Ford talking unibody Ranger replacement
Mon, 18 Feb 2013Now here's some welcome news. Car and Driver reports Ford is seriously mulling a replacement for the recently deceased Ranger, but the successor to the compact pickup's throne may not look anything like what we've seen from the nameplate in the past.
While speaking at the 2013 Chicago Auto Show, Doug Scott, marketing manager for Ford Trucks, said there's still a market for a smaller pickup, but that buyers expect to see a larger differentiation between the smaller utility vehicles and their full size counterparts in price, capability and fuel economy.
According to Scott, that means a vehicle with a payload capacity of around 1,000 pounds paired with a towing capacity of 3,000 pounds and "a dramatic reduction in fuel consumption." But the biggest piece of that recipe is the price tag, and Scott says to keep the MSRP far enough away from the already cheap F-150, the answer could come in the form of a unibody design. Scott says target customers in this market don't care whether the truck has a traditional frame or not, so long as it's tough enough to do the job and has the capability they need.
